
We present the ELIOT Experiment Builder (ELIOT), an open-source experiment builder that specializes in the integration of external hardware units into standardized laboratory experiments. ELIOT allows for various study designs that are customizable using HTML, CSS, and JSON. As an application for modularized JavaScript, it ensures flexible, robust, and comprehensive integration as well as synchronization of external hardware, by building on popular software frameworks. Studies and hardware code are packaged so that they can be shared with and adapted by other researchers, facilitating replication and standardization between laboratories. This paper serves as a tutorial to ELIOT. Weprovide an overview of the functionality, define terminology within ELIOT and explain the software’s internal architecture. Central to data representation and collection in ELIOT are JSON objects. We therefore include a short introduction to JSON for behavioral researchers who are unfamiliar with the data format. The software code is provided under an open-source license and is available along with further documentation, ready-to-use installers, and support channels at https://github.com/eliot-org/eliot-experiment-builder.
JavaScript, FOS: Psychology, Experiment, Open-source, Hardware, JSON, Experimental Design and Sample Surveys, Psychology, Psychology, other, Quantitative Methods, Social and Behavioral Sciences, Hardware integration, Software
JavaScript, FOS: Psychology, Experiment, Open-source, Hardware, JSON, Experimental Design and Sample Surveys, Psychology, Psychology, other, Quantitative Methods, Social and Behavioral Sciences, Hardware integration, Software
| selected citations These citations are derived from selected sources. This is an alternative to the "Influence" indicator, which also reflects the overall/total impact of an article in the research community at large, based on the underlying citation network (diachronically). | 0 | |
| popularity This indicator reflects the "current" impact/attention (the "hype") of an article in the research community at large, based on the underlying citation network. | Average | |
| influence This indicator reflects the overall/total impact of an article in the research community at large, based on the underlying citation network (diachronically). | Average | |
| impulse This indicator reflects the initial momentum of an article directly after its publication, based on the underlying citation network. | Average |
